Disease
Mode of transmission
(a) Amoebiasis
Direct and oral. The tetranucleate cysts are ingested with contaminated food and water.
(b) Malaria
Indirect and inoculative. The sporozoites are introduced along with the saliva of vector female Anopheles mosquitoes.
(c) Ascariasis
Direct and oral. Capsules with second juveniles are ingested with contaminated food and water.
(d) Pneumonia
Air borne or through droplet infection or aerosols or contaminated utensils. Bacterial cysts are spread by sputum of the patients.
